Lay a Damp Proof Membrane DPMDue to the fact that the damp-proof course around my garage has been known to leak during heavy rain, I wasn't going to take any risks with flooding in future. So even though I have dug a soak-away around the outside of the garage, and treated the inner and outer surfaces of the walls with damp sealant, I still thought it sensible to add a damp-proof membrane. The damp-proof membrane is just a regular plastic ground sheet available from any builders merchant. It is attached to the wall simply using masonry screws and washers.
Before it was laid, the
floor had to swept carefully to make sure there were no sharp objects left
behind. Once the membrane is down, you must be careful not to puncture it by
walking too much on it.
